c performance array linked-list. share|improve this question.If you time just removing the item from the list, it probably will be faster. What youre timing is traversing the list to the correct point, then removing the item. Copy first two elements to the end of an existing array: string existing new string words.CopyTo(0, existing, 998, 2)Next ». « Previous. Home » C Tutorial » List. C ArrayList is a non-generic dynamic size collection class. ArrayList class exists in System.Collections namespace. ArrayList are dynamic means we can add any number of items without specifying the size of it.It is an older data type and generic List or array can provide better performance than it. It wont throw any compile time error.It will throw only run time error when we iterate values in the array list by using for each.Var - dynamic difference C 4.0? c. php.I tried the following to test the performance of array and ArrayList. I know That arrayList is backed-up by array, but i saw strange behavior while accessing the data from list and array as mentioned below The following table lists the difference between Array and ArrayList in C.Items of ArrayList need to be cast to appropriate data type while retriving. Use static helper class Array to perform different tasks on the array. Looping in C. Foreach Statement. List.
Creating a List. Queue, Stack, Dictionary. Reading. Introduction to C Properties, Arrays, Loops, Lists. Game Design Experience Professor Jim Whitehead. In C, arrays and lists are both objects that can be used to hold variables, but they arent exactly interchangeable. In C, an array must be declared using brackets and must be accompanied by the type of variables it will hold (integers or strings) and by its name.
performance. few weeks ago i discovered the List <> of c (i know am slow and since then, i found myself using List everywhere i used to use arrays. and the deal is that am sure that each one has its own advantage, but i just cant see what is better with array then List? Difference Between Array List and Array in C.Array-Lists are not strongly typed. Elements in Arrays have to be of same data type (int, string, double, char, bool). Elements in Array-List can have a combination of combined data types or single data type. Im using .Net 3.5 (C) and Ive heard the performance of C List.ToArray is "bad", since it memory copies for all elements to form a new array. C Arrays. Array is a collection of many values of the same type. The array can be one or multi-dimensional array.C OOP Circularly Linked List. Certainly, this is the best method in terms of Code Clarity and Maintenance, which are generally way more important than the actual performance.searching an array list. copy of list iterator. Browse more C / C Sharp Questions on Bytes. Related resources for List in C No resource found. Difference Between Array And ArrayList In C1/30/2018 5:37:58 PM. This blog will give us an idea ofthe differences between Array and ArrayList and we can figure out when to use Array and when to use ArrayList while programming. Im using .Net 3.5 (C) and Ive heard the performance of C List.ToArray is bad, since it memory copies for all elements to form a new array. The reason for this excellent performance is because the intermediate language that the c compiler compiles to has native support for arrays. I am sure at least a few of you must have a nagging question regarding the performance results, after all the array list of the generic list classes uses an Dialog Template Resources. Displaying in a window. Display Performance. Font Handling.In C, arrays are derived from the System.Array class. There are lot of properties and methods in this class we canTwo-dimensional array int[,] y. Listing 6 explains the usage of multidimensional arrays SAPrefs - Netscape-like Preferences Dialog. Visualization and comparison of sorting algorithms in C. Window Tabs (WndTabs) Add-In for2. You cannot really warn that List have performance cost. They provide more flexibility compared to arrays and i think the slight performance hit is worth while. C List. An array does not dynamically resize.Alternatively: You can assign the List to null instead of calling Clear, with similar performance. But: After assigning to null, you must call the constructor again to avoid getting a NullReferenceException. In C 2.0 and later, single-dimensional arrays that have a lower bound of zero automatically implement IList. ThisThe following code example demonstrates how a single generic method that takes an IList input parameter can iterate through both a list and an array, in this case an array of integers. This video shows the difference in the performance between Array and ArryList Before watching This video Please Watch Array in tamil C.net Video and ArrayLiC ArrayList vs List - Duration: 7:14. T vs. List can make a big performance difference. I just optimized an extremely (nested) loop intensive application to move from lists to arrays on .NET 4.0.Generic List vs Array. 5. Most efficient C SharePoint List iteration. 1. Create dynamically attributes name inside a for-loop statement. C arrays implicitly implement interfaces from the Sytem.Collections and System.Collections.Generic . int IntArr new int Type of Arrays Casting an array to a List Implicitly in C :- IList intlist IntArr Performance is good since all it does is memory copy all elements () to form a new array. Of course it depends on what you define as "good" or "bad" performance. () references for reference types, values for value types. In this part of the C programming tutorial, we will cover arrays. We will initiate arrays and read data from them. C array definition. An array is a collection of data. A scalar variable can hold only one item at a time. Todays article wonders about how much performance is lost to gain this convenience and tests the List class against the lowly C array: T. How much performance are you giving up with List and why is that happening? However there is little information about ArrayList performance characteristics on MSDN.All the items in the ArrayList will be copied from the old Array to the new Array.Incidentally heres an apparent ArrayList bug I noticed. Heres some c code: using SystemDoes everything you have said about ArrayList also apply to List? c. Array Contains Performance. I have a program which works with arrays and at some point I have to check if a lsit of values are inside an array, the functionAnyway, thanks to everyone that helped :) Instead of shuffle, you can generate the possible values in a list and take values at random positions. Browse other questions tagged c arrays performance list arraylist or ask your own question.Convert list to array in Java. 772. Swift performance: sorting arrays. Converts an array of any type to List passing a mapping delegate Func